What should I do ??

What's up guys , my evo made 336/328 on a mustang dyno with 02 dump ets test pipe ams catback and 3 port. I'm stuck if I should do front mount with piping with a Cai and get retuned and call it a day or what I just said but also injectors fuel pump and ef3 turbo. I changed my mind on building the evo so I want to know which would be the better way out. I love power and I don't drive the car to work I just drive the car just to drive. Let me know what you guys think... If I get a front mount and cai wil I make 360/~340 on a mustang dyno???

i agree with ets michael, if you want to go bigger turbo, might as well save up and get a kit it comes out to be about the same, but better for the long run. i wish i did that when i first got my car. Do the math and youll see its not a huge difference in price. remember you can always sell your stock parts and your current parts that the kit comes with.
